The opportunity 

Kristin School is a co-educational, non-denominational, independent school on Auckland’s North Shore. It provides education for more than 1800 students from Early Learning to Year 13, with dual pathways through NCEA and the International Baccalaureate programme.

We are seeking an inspiring teacher for English from Year 9-13. The successful candidate will work as part of a team that seeks to develop its professional practice via a collaborative inquiry-based professional development programme. Commitment to the school’s co-curricular programme and camp week is also integral to the role. This role is fixed term for 12 months to cover a period of parental leave.
